Code P0871 indicates a "Transmission Fluid Pressure Sensor/Switch C Circuit Range/Performance"
Factor in you may need to have the transmission rebuilt.

So what tranny is in this 2015 6.4l gasser?

The garbage one. IMO, it's worth the money to go for 2019+ to get the ZF 8 speed. Its a better driving experience and it's significantly more durable. In half tons the 6 speed is fine, but drive an HD back to back with each and you'll throw rocks at the 6 speed one.
